SRINAGAR, APRIL 21: Minister for Agriculture Production, Rural Development & Panchayati Raj, Cooperative, and Election Department, Javid Ahmad Dar, has voiced serious concern over the damage caused to orchards and farmland following the recent heavy rains and hailstorms in Jammu & Kashmir.
The severe weather has significantly affected standing crops and horticulture, especially in North and South Kashmir.
In response, the Minister has instructed the Agriculture and Horticulture Department heads to begin immediate loss assessment across all districts. He directed them to send joint field teams, in coordination with District Administrations, to evaluate the damages and submit reports for timely relief.
Stressing the need for accurate and swift reporting, the Minister urged officials to be thorough in gathering data.
He reassured the farming community that the Omar Abdullah-led government is committed to supporting them during this difficult period, and the UT administration is actively working on suitable relief measures.
